A luge and its rider, with a total mass of 110 kg, emerge from a downhill track onto ahorizontal straight track with an initial speedof 70 m/s. Assume that they stopwith a constant deceleration of 1.9 m/s2. (a) What magnitude F is required for thedecelerating force?N
(b) What distance d do they travel whiledecelerating?
m
(c) What work W is done on them by thedecelerating force?
kJ
. (d) What is F for a decelerationof 3.8 m/s2?
N
(e) What is d for a decelerationof 3.8 m/s2?
m
(f) What is W for a decelerationof 3.8 m/s2?
kJ
